7,8-Dibromo-2-chloro-9-methyl-5,6-dihydro-4H-imidazo[4,5,1-ij]quinoline Basic information
Product Name:7,8-Dibromo-2-chloro-9-methyl-5,6-dihydro-4H-imidazo[4,5,1-ij]quinoline
Synonyms:7,8-Dibromo-2-chloro-9-methyl-5,6-dihydro-4H-imidazo[4,5,1-ij]quinoline;4H-Imidazo[4,5,1-ij]quinoline, 7,8-dibromo-2-chloro-5,6-dihydro-9-methyl-;7,8-Dibromo-2-chloro-5,6-dihydro-9-methyl-4H-imidazo[4,5,1-ij]quinoline;Ethanone,1-[6-hydroxy-2,3-dimethoxy-9-(phenylmethoxy)phenyl]-;3,4-dihydro-2-(methylthio)-4-oxo-7-pyrimdineaceticacidethylester
CAS:1609452-31-4
MF:C11H9Br2ClN2
MW:364.46356

7,8-Dibromo-2-chloro-9-methyl-5,6-dihydro-4H-imidazo[4,5,1-ij]quinoline Chemical Properties
Boiling point 492.6±55.0 °C(Predicted)
density 2.10±0.1 g/cm3(Predicted)
storage temp. under inert gas (nitrogen or Argon) at 2-8°C
pka2.46±0.20(Predicted)

7,8-Dibromo-2-chloro-9-methyl-5,6-dihydro-4H-imidazo[4,5,1-IJ]quinoline was synthesized as follows (Method 2A): 2-chloro-9-methyl-5,6-dihydro-4H-imidazo[4,5,1-IJ]quinoline (11.7 g, 56 mmol, Method 14A) was dissolved in acetonitrile (250 mL) pre-cooled to 0 °C in acetonitrile (250 mL). Subsequently, N-bromosuccinimide (50.0 g, 282 mmol) was added in batches over 1 hour. The reaction mixture was continued to be stirred at 0 °C for 30 min, after which it was brought to room temperature and stirred for 48 hours. After completion of the reaction, the solvent was removed by distillation under reduced pressure. The residue was dissolved in dichloromethane and washed with saturated aqueous sodium bicarbonate. The organic layer was dried over anhydrous sodium sulfate, filtered and concentrated the filtrate to afford 18.6 g of the target product 7,8-dibromo-2-chloro-9-methyl-5,6-dihydro-4H-imidazo[4,5,1-IJ]quinoline in 90% yield. The product was characterized by LC-MS (m/z 364.8 [M + 1]) and 1H NMR (600 MHz, DMSO) δ 4.12 (t, 2H, CH2), 2.88 (t, 2H, CH2), 2.57 (s, 3H, CH3), 2.22-2.18 (m, 2H, CH2).

References[1] Patent: WO2014/72435, 2014, A1. Location in patent: Page/Page column 79
